HVAC Inverter Drives - Controls - Energy Optimisation
Today the vast majority of new public building projects use AC drives for the fans, pumps and compressors on the air conditioning systems. Globally, Danfoss finds itself at the heart of such projects, VLT® drives being selected for their compatibility with most BMS control systems, simplifying and reducing installation costs. This ensures close comfortable control of the building environment and facilitates simple updating of the system. Prestige buildings such as the Natural History Museum, the ‘Gherkin’ and the Crowne Plaza Copenhagen Towers all use VLT® HVAC Drives to control their environments. The recent installation at Brighton and Sussex University Hospitals has resulted in energy savings of £48,000 (533,000 kWh) and reduced CO2 emissions by 288 tonnes.
Designed specifically for fan, pump and compressor applications, especially within the building services environment. Dedicated to applications within the air conditioning market, the VLT® HVAC Drive is the world’s leading HVAC drive. Power sizes range from 1.1kW to 1.4MW in a variety of IP rated enclosures.
Enclosure Choice - Available in IP00, IP20, IP55 and IP66 enclosures as standard. The ‘bookshelf’ designs are available for high-density panel installations. The ultra-compact IP55 enclosures are easily mounted directly on a wall, the AHU or pump skid. The IP66 option is suitable for external use.
User Centred Design - Programming simplified. From the initiation of the design process, Danfoss design engineers spent weeks ‘in the shoes’ of the end users. The result is the extremely user friendly and intuitive award winning human-machine interface that reflects familiarity with mobile phone use. The alpha-numeric graphical keypad displays clear English text.
Automatic Energy Optimiser (AEO) - Ensures maximum energy savings by optimising the motor’s magnetic field under all load conditions. This feature also simplifies drive set-up and minimises motor noise levels.
Sleep Mode - In this mode the drive detects situations with low or zero flow. Instead of continuous operation, it boosts system pressure and then stops to save energy and starts again when the pressure falls below the lower set-point.
Serial Communications - Compatibility with BACnet, Modbus RTU, METASYS and SIEMENS FLN as standard and can be delivered with the Lonworks open protocol as a built in option.
Fire Override Mode - In the event of fire the drive will run until eventual self-destruction. It can be set to maintain a higher level of air pressure than in other parts of the building, ensuring that fire escapes remain clear of smoke.

Power Factor - Maintains near unity power factor at all loads and speeds and minimises the need for power factor correction equipment, giving both space and financial savings.
EMC - Electromagnetic Compatibility - Electromagnetic ‘noise’ is an important consideration when ensuring compatibility between frequency converters and other building services equipment, computers or other sensitive equipment in the building environment. Meets all international standards on EMC compatibility on both emissions and susceptibility.
Harmonics - The importance of chokes and filters in all medium and high power applications cannot be overstated. The integral chokes and filters in the VLT® HVAC Drive ensure that mains harmonics are minimised while output cable length to the motor is maximised, eliminating the need for output line chokes.
Motors do not have to be de-rated to allow for the harmonic content of the output waveform and the output circuit can if necessary be broken under load without auxiliary control switching or concern for switching surges.
